Mechanical Engineering Seniors Showcase Innovation at Capstone Design Mini-Expo

August 4, 2026
By Tracie Troha

Bus Lightyears and Team E took home first- and second-place honors, respectively, at the Summer 2026 Georgia Tech Capstone Design Mini-Expo held on July 28.

At the expo, over 30 mechanical engineering seniors representing five teams showcased projects developed during the Capstone Design course.

First-place winner Bus Lightyears, composed of Dmitry Demin, Jaehyeok Kim, Luke Kim, Rihan Mammen, James Millington, and Cayden Walker, received $1,500 for their standardized satellite bus designed to simplify the integration of 450-kilogram-class payloads for commercial space missions.

Unlike traditional mission-specific spacecraft structures, the team’s proposed design provides a reusable platform with a configurable interior mounting interface that could reduce development time, engineering effort, and integration costs for future missions.

“We did market research and analyzed data from SpaceX launches,” Demin said. “We also gathered consumer feedback and incorporated it into our design.”

Mammen said the team spent two months designing and building the satellite bus and received assistance from the Montgomery Machining Mall.

“I’m very proud of everyone on this team for working on this project,” Mammen said.

Second-place winner Team E, composed of Ethan Falls, Alan Gomez, Labeeba Shafique, Sanjay Siram, Moumita Sutar, and Tyson Tran, received $500 for Baby Bot, a device designed to replicate the physical behavior of infants ages 1 to 7 months.

Sponsored by Todd Sulchek, professor and Regent’s Innovator at the George W. Woodruff School of Mechanical Engineering, Baby Bot simulates rolling, hip rotation, leg lifting, and head movement through a system of DC gear motors, servo motors, and an Arduino-class controller.

Integrated sensors detect airway obstructions and thermal hazards in real time, and the system logs data across repeated standardized test cycles. The primary application is bassinet safety testing, although the device can be adapted for swings, sleepers, and other products.

“We picked this project because we thought it was really interesting,” Falls said. “It was great to apply the research and test our coding.”

Siram added that she enjoyed working on the project because it addressed an important safety issue.

“It addresses real issues and keeps babies safe,” she said.

The other teams that presented projects at the expo included:

  • Lift Assist, which designed a device intended to help emergency medical services personnel assist patients who have fallen and cannot get up independently. The idea was inspired by team member Isaac Tuttle, an emergency medical technician with Grady Health System.
  • The Jiao Jokers, which designed a smart motorized bike-fit adjustment system that prioritizes affordability, ergonomics, and accessibility.
  • Seal the Deal, which designed a leakproof solution bath to scale up the manufacturing process of tubular hollow fibers. The project was sponsored by the HARRiS Group.
